Dimensions 7 mm and 11 mm are the
space taken up by the frame of the
appliance on the worktop.
^ Make a cut-out for the hob in the
worktop, paying attention to the
appliance height. See section
"Appliance dimensions".
Dimension "B" applies to a combination
of appliances and is shown on the
chart.
Due to the heat radiated by the hob
and to allow cooking fumes to
dissipate it is essential that a
minimum safety distance is
maintained between the worktop
cut-out and adjacent kitchen units,
e.g. a tall unit. See Warning and
Safety instructions.
^
Seal the cut surfaces with a suitable
sealant to avoid swelling caused by
moisture. The materials used must be
heat resistant.

Important:
The maximum tolerance for the worktop
cut-out must not exceed±1mm.
When building in several combiset
appliances a spacer bar must be
fitted between each unit. (See
"Fitting the spacer bars and spring
clamps").
